形容词 adj.
-
Excessively concerned with rules and order, always serious.
— Don't be so uptight! You won't go to jail for crossing the street against the light.
- Emotionally repressed; nervous and tense.
-
Sexually repressed.
— He came from a very uptight religious background, but you wouldn't know that now!
-
Unfriendly or rude.
